Lanarkshire / Re: Baxter/ Henderson/ Hamilton/ Williamson
« on: Thursday 23 May 19 00:15 BST (UK)  »
Hi,
Maria Henderson was my grandmother and she married a William John Auld in Belfast on 18 July 1900 and subsequently had 2 daughters Maria Teresa and Wilhelmina.  Maria was my mother who died when I was very young (and I am now very old!) but I would dearly love to know more about my grandmother who it would seem separated from my grandfather I don't know when.  Cannot find any trace.
